MoreOn October 12, 2023, the Revenue Department of the Ministry of Finance of India issued a decision to continue imposing an anti - dumping duty for 5 years on flax yarn with a fineness of less than 70 denier or less than 42 counts, which is originated from or imported from China. The article details the background, process and latest situation of Indias anti - dumping duty decision on Chinese flax yarn.
